Transaction fdd91684b5f2e1beb225ecad96ab4dabec96f53099a83f20d389afb8246e6dc1
1 Input
1 Output
-
fdd91684b5f2e1beb225ecad96ab4dabec96f53099a83f20d389afb8246e6dc1:0
- value
- 594480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dbd901913d2b53e7ef9143c360e0676a402a0a6 OP_EQUAL
- address
- 35rsREeYEXSKhSc3KZxGMNztRj2K1gaZcX